Tex mex Ziti

Ingredients
  • 12 ounces pkg ziti pasta
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 small onion, chopped
  • 2 cups spaghetti sauce
  • 1 cup picante sauce
  • 15 ounces container ricotta cheese
  • 2 cups shredded Mexican cheese blend
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ro or parsley
Instructions

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Coat a 9 x 13-inch baking dish with nonstick cooking spray. Cook ziti according to package directions; drain. Set aside in a large bowl. Meanwhile, in a large skillet, cook ground beef and onion over medium heat 5 minutes, stirring occasionally; drain. Add to the ziti, along with the spaghetti sauce, picante sauce, ricotta cheese, and 1 cup of the Mexican cheese blend; mix well. Spoon into the baking dish and bake 25 minutes. Remove from the oven and sprinkle the top with remaining 1 cup Mexican cheese blend. Return to the oven and bake about 10 minutes, or until the cheese melts. Sprinkle with chopped cilantro and serve.
